Mr. Takorn Tantasith, Secretary of the National Broadcasting and Telecommunications Commission (NBTC Secretary), attended "The ITU Telecommunication/ICT Indicators Symposium" at Hiroshima, Japan from November 30 – December 2, 2015. At the event, the International Telecommunications Union (ITU) revealed the results of Global Telecommunication/ICT Indicators of each country. According to the data, Thailand has moved up to 74th rank in 2014 from 81st rank in 2013 thanks to the launching of 3G service on 2.1 GHz band in 2013. 

Mr. Takorn also added that Thailand was an interesting case and has therefore remained as a case study for ITU throughout the past years.    

"From the last 1800 MHz and 900 MHz band auction for 4G service, we can be sure that Thailand’s ICT development will likely move to higher ranks in the future,” confirmed Mr. Takorn.

Meanwhile, based on the 1800 MHz band auction that has just recently ended on November 12, 2015, the launching of 4G service on 1800 MHz band can be expected before January 2016 whereas 900 MHz band auction is scheduled to take place this upcoming December 15, 2015.
